Along with the authors' follow-up book on advanced topics, this text provides students with a broad, up-to-date introduction to quantum mechanics. The text offers a graduate-level account of the behavior of matter and energy at the molecular, atomic, nuclear, and sub-nuclear levels. It presents the latest mathematical treatments, theoretical methods, applications, and experimental observations. A collection of problems at the end of each chapter develops students' understanding of both basic concepts and the application of theory to various physically important systems.
